12 Prayers for Each Month of the New Year

Do you already have activities planned for the New Year? Perhaps your planner is filling up with appointments and events. If so, consider adding prayer to your calendar. To help, we’ve created 12 prayers for each month of the New Year. Bookmark this post for future reference, and make time with God a priority in 2026.

January

Lord God, Creator of new beginnings, please help me start this New Year with a clear vision of Your purpose. Help me establish strong and healthy rhythms that set the pace for the rest of the year. When I’m tempted to look back to better days, remind me that You are preparing a bright and beautiful future for me. With You, I cannot fail. Thank You, Lord, for leading me in strength and wisdom this New Year. In Jesus’ name, amen.
Make Prayer a Priority: Pray through the Psalms this month, committing a few key passages to memory.
February

Loving Father, this month I meditate on Proverbs 3:3, which says, “Let love and faithfulness never leave you; bind them around your neck, write them on the tablet of your heart.” Please fill my heart with Your love, Father, the love that never fails. And when my faith wavers, show me Your faithfulness. Because of Your sacrifice, I am made whole. I am deeply loved and valued, and in turn, I am able to love others. Thank You, Lord, for all You are. In Jesus’ name, amen.
Make Prayer a Priority: Meditate on 1 Corinthians 13 this month, also known as the “love chapter.”
March

Holy God, there’s much to look forward to as winter ends and spring begins. Though the days are still dreary at times, I am filled with hope. As the season changes, please remind me that You never change. You are the same yesterday, today, and tomorrow. This helps me stay grounded in faith, walking steadfastly no matter what crosses my path. Thank You for brighter days ahead. My hope is in You. In Jesus’ name, amen.
Make Prayer a Priority: Fill a jar with 31 prayer prompts and choose one each day.
April

Lord and Savior, what a beautiful month to celebrate Your life, death, and resurrection. You are worthy of my praise! Because of the empty tomb, I walk in new life. Freedom surrounds me because Your Spirit is with me. As 2 Corinthians 3:17 says, “Where the Spirit of the Lord is there is freedom.” Thank You for setting me free from sin and death. I owe everything to You. In Your precious name, amen.
Make Prayer a Priority: Praise God for the gift of salvation, and consider sharing your testimony with one person this month.
